Dukes of September embark on second summer outing

The Dukes of September Rhythm Revue supergroup, comprised of Donald Fagen, Michael McDonald and Boz Scaggs, will take to the North American tour trail this summer for the second time since their 2010 inception.
The trio next take the stage Wednesday (6/38) in Santa Rosa, CA, and will follow it up with four more California gigs through early July before working their way eastward across the continent. The 37-city itinerary, which includes a two-night stand Aug. 1-2 in New York City, wraps up Aug. 24 in Indianapolis.
Tickets for the summertime trek are available now via the group's website.
The Dukes, who organized in 2010, will be backed by Fagen's Steely Dan band for this outing, according to a recent Rolling Stone interview.
"When you're a solo artist for a few years, there's a part of you that longs for that journeyman status," McDonald told the magazine. "This situation fulfills that urge for all of us. It's like something after school -- going to the sandlot, playing ball or something."
Though they've not ruled out a Dukes album, two of the three of chart-topping musicians are working on their own solo projects: Scaggs is finishing up writing a new studio effort, while McDonald is working on a set of covers with his son Dylan, according to the interview.
